Job Details

Key Accountabilities:

Supervise any of the departmental technical capabilities not limited to:

Simulation

Guidance & Control

Tracking System

Software Development [SIL and PIL]

Lab Testing and Performance Verification

Mission Planning

Mentoring Engineers Not Limited To:

Junior Engineers

Engineer I

Engineer II

Flight Test

Pre-Flight Preparation

Flight Test

Post-Flight Analysis

Capability Establishment and Tools

Establish Guidance & Control Capabilities

Establish Infrastructure, Tools, and Labs

Supports the principal engineer in the form of technical contributions

Experience & Education Qualifications:

At least 6-10 years’ experience working on guided weapon systems or relevant experience and certifications.

Bachelor’s, Master’s or PhD degree in relevant fields (i.e. electrical, mechanical, embedded systems, aerospace engineering, etc.)

Experience in the use of engineering tools and developing and implementing guidance and control algorithms.

Detailed knowledge of the engineering discipline and the development of guided weapon systems.
